Last weekend, Rari Capital was hit with an attack that left them down by 2600 ETH – which was around 60% of all user funds in the Rari Capital Ethereum Pool.

A DeFi company that automates yield farming by rebalancing users’ funds and pools, the attack seems to have been carried out by “evil contract” exploits affecting the HomoraBank contract.

There has been an exploit in the Rari Capital ETH Pool related to our @AlphaFinanceLab integration.

The rebalancer has removed all funds from Alpha in response.

We are currently investigating the situation and a full report will be shared once everything is assessed.

— Rari Capital (@RariCapital) May 8, 2021

However, Alpha Finance Lab itself seems to not have been affected.

Funds are SAFE on #AlphaHomora.

We are notified that @RariCapital has suffered from an exploit that was due to the incorrect assumption when using HomoraBank contract, as they were setting up an ibETH pool on their platform.#Alpha team is here to help.

— Alpha Finance Lab (@AlphaFinanceLab) May 8, 2021

The hacker’s message

Currently in possession of an ETH wallet recently emptied into Tornado.Cash Proxy transactions, the hacker took the time to leave a tongue-in-cheek message to the recently attacked DeFi firm.

However, the message also seems to indicate that Alpha Homora’s security prevented Rari from taking yet another $6 million in losses.

In an update by the founder of Rari Jai Bhavnani, holders of the DeFi firms tRGT token will be able to claim reimbursement in RGT – up to a total sum off all reimbursed losses of $26 million.

While it was indeed initially meant to scale the team, all of the protocol contributors have elected to give that 2M $RGT back to the DAO with the ask of using the newly acquired $RGT to reimburse lost funds and reward those that helped in the war room.

Jai Bhavnani, founder of Rari Capital

The price of RGT dropped steeply after the attack, losing nearly half of its value. Reportedly it has been proposed that the reimbursement funds will be taken from the developer incentive stash held by the DeFi company, in possession of 1% of all RGT.
